    About Jamiezon Assisted Living Home

    Jamiezon Assisted Living Home sits about 5 miles outside Anchorage, Alaska, at 2280 Lake George Drive, and has five assisted living units, so it feels like a small, tight-knit community that's able to help seniors keep some independence while also giving needed help with things like dressing, grooming, and moving around. The staff knows how to take care of folks who have memory issues, like Alzheimer's or Parkinson's, and they make personalized service plans for each resident, which means everyone gets care that feels right for them, and the home offers both assisted living and memory care, plus some nursing care if it's needed.

    There are choices between one-bedroom suites, studio layouts, or even shared rooms, and some rooms have kitchenettes and private spaces, which gives people options, depending on what they need. Staff are trained to help with daily activities, and there are emergency systems in every room, so help's there when someone needs it quickly, and they make routines with bathroom reminders and regular checks on residents' health. Residents get help with medication, laundry, housework, dressing, bathing, and there's always someone around to lend a hand or just visit with, and there's scheduled transportation for outings, doctor's visits, and trips to places in the neighborhood, which includes parks, cafes, pharmacies, and even spots like Ding How restaurant for a meal now and then.

    Jamiezon Assisted Living Home has a cooking staff with a culinary chef and a bistro for dining, so meals are prepared several ways to fit special diets, including allergies and diabetes, and there's a dining room and snacks throughout the day. The place makes room for hobbies and social time, with features like a garden, greenhouse, arts and crafts studio, reading area, fitness room, beauty salon, barbershop, a game room, and cable TV and WiFi so people can relax and keep busy, and walking paths and gardens make it easy to get outside for some fresh air. Housekeeping, maintenance, and laundry are handled by the staff, which lets residents focus on things they enjoy, and safety features like sprinklers and handrails help everyone move about safely.

    There are special care programs for memory issues, occupational therapy, and support for Parkinson's disease, and Jamiezon has caregivers trained for dementia and Alzheimer's, which gives families some peace of mind. The home arranges for regular assessments and personalized care plans, making sure staff ratios fit residents' needs, and the team can connect with outside healthcare and coordinate podiatry, wound care, or other professional help if needed. Activities happen every day-social programs, crafts, games, movie nights, and educational events-so people have choices for staying active and involved, and there are both in-person and virtual tours for people thinking about moving in, with clear information about costs and waiting lists.

    Jamiezon Assisted Living Home LLC has operated since 2015 as a registered limited liability company, the registered agent is Corazon Garcia, and it's kept its licensing and inspection records up to date. The home aims to help each person feel supported and safe, offering both privacy and a sense of community in a cozy, family-style setting, and gives seniors and their families honest guidance about care types, what to expect, and how to find the right fit for each resident.
